While many designers gravitate towards trends, Rachel Pally stays true to the elegantly draped dresses, wide-leg pants and feminine tops that put her on the map some 15 years ago.
Her line, which includes plus sizes and maternity, can be found at stores including Neiman Marcus and Pea in the Pod…. and at rachelpally.com.
Rachel shares with Linda how she stumbled into designing clothes at 22 and launched her business with $300 dollars of babysitting money, how she believes being a business woman makes her a better mom to her two sons and her belief that women should dress in a way that compliments their curves, and avoids pain and discomfort.
